How long does it take to learn Spanish?
Most learners can hold basic conversations in Spanish within 2-3 months of daily practice. Reaching conversational fluency typically takes 6-12 months depending on your native language and practice intensity.
Is Spanish hard to learn for English speakers?
Spanish is one of the easiest languages for English speakers, with familiar vocabulary and straightforward pronunciation. With the right approach — focusing on conversation over grammar rules — most people surprise themselves with how quickly they progress.
